ASP.NET CheckBoxList kontrolü

Tanım ve Kullanım

CheckBoxList kontrolü, çoklu seçim çift seçim kutusu grubu oluşturmak için kullanılır.

Her CheckBoxList kontrolündeki seçenekler, ListItem öğesi tarafından tanımlanır!

İpucu:Bu kontrol, veri bağlama destekler!

Özellikler

Özellikler Açıklama .NET
CellPadding Tablo hücrelerinin etkinlikleri ile arasındaki piksel sayısı. 1.0
CellSpacing Tablo hücreleri arasındaki piksel sayısı. 1.0
RepeatColumns Çift seçim kutusu grubunu gösterirken kullanılan sütun sayısı. 1.0
RepeatDirection Çift seçim kutusu grubunun yatay mı yoksa dikey mi tekrar edileceğini belirtir. 1.0
RepeatLayout Çift seçim kutusu grubunun düzeni. 1.0
runat Bu kontrolü sunucu kontrolü olarak belirler. "server" olarak ayarlanmalıdır. 1.0
TextAlign Metin, çift seçim kutusunun yanında görüntülenir. 1.0

ListControl standart özellikleri

AppendDataBoundItems, AutoPostBack, CausesValidation, DataTextField,
DataTextFormatString, DataValueField, Items, runat, SelectedIndex, SelectedItem,
SelectedValue, TagKey, Text, ValidationGroup, OnSelectedIndexChanged

ListControl kontrolü, list kontrolerinin tüm temel işlevlerini içerir. Bu kontrolü miras alan kontroller: CheckBoxList, DropDownList, ListBox ve RadioButtonList kontrolüdür.

Tam bir açıklama için ListControl standart özellikleri.

Web Denetleyici Standart Özellikleri

AccessKey, Attributes, BackColor, BorderColor, BorderStyle, BorderWidth, 
CssClass, Enabled, Font, EnableTheming, ForeColor, Height, IsEnabled, 
SkinID, Style, TabIndex, ToolTip, Width

Tam bir açıklama için Web Denetleyici Standart Özellikleri.

Denetleyici Standart Özellikleri

AppRelativeTemplateSourceDirectory, BindingContainer, ClientID, Controls, 
EnableTheming, EnableViewState, ID, NamingContainer, Page, Parent, Site, 
TemplateControl, TemplateSourceDirectory, UniqueID, Visible

Tam bir açıklama içinDenetleyici Standart Özellikleri.

Örneği

CheckBoxList
Bu örnekte, .aspx dosyasında bir CheckBoxList denetleyicisi tanımlıyoruz. Daha sonra SelectedIndexChanged olayı için bir olay işleyicisi oluşturuyoruz. Bu seçim listesi altı onay kutusunu içerir. Kullanıcı birini seçtiğinde, sayfa otomatik olarak sunucuya geri gönderilir ve Check alt programı çalıştırılır. Bu alt program, denetleyicinin Items koleksiyonunu tarar ve her bir öğenin Selected özelliğini test eder. Seçilen öğeler Label denetleyicisinde gösterilir.